Why is design protection important for businesses?

Design protection allows businesses to secure exclusive rights over the look of a product, including its shape, configuration, pattern, or ornamentation.

In the UK, unregistered design rights arise automatically, but registering your design provides stronger, more easily enforceable protection. Qualifying for design protection

To qualify for design protection, a design must be new and have individual character. This means it should not be identical or too similar to existing designs already available to the public. Timing is therefore critical, public disclosure before filing can affect your ability to secure rights, so early advice is highly recommended.

Registered design protection can last up to 25 years in the UK, subject to renewal every five years. This provides long-term security for products with enduring commercial value, such as consumer goods, packaging, and digital interfaces. Beyond registration, businesses should adopt a proactive approach to managing their designs. Keeping accurate records of creation, monitoring the market for potential infringements, and taking swift action where necessary are all key to maintaining the strength of your rights.

Design protection also plays an important commercial role. It can enhance brand recognition, increase the value of your product portfolio, and create opportunities for licensing or collaboration.
